Posted: Tue Feb 02, 2010 7:26 am Post subject: Health Insurance Coverage |
|
|
| Health insurance companies generally discriminate against those with HIV. Most of the time they increase the premium or reduce coverage in the policy. The easiest way to get a health insurance policy would be taking a group policy. If your are working for an employer with 15 or more employees at present, you have the right to the same insurance coverage provided to the other employees under the Federal law. If you are unable to work due to your present health conditions or is between employers make sure you use COBRA effectively. You can seek health coverage through state government or through an agency which provides Universal health coverage. However, you might face problems if you are an individual purchaser due to the social discrimination. |
